Abstract
We describe how intercell interference can be mitigated in the uplink of UTRA TDD (TD-CDMA). The intercell interference mitigation technique is based on reusing existing multiuser detector architectures that are derived from linear receivers. Through simulation results we determine the efficiency of the scheme when operating under different channel conditions, with different numbers of users and different levels of intercell interference. Using a simple TD-CDMA uplink capacity equation we demonstrate the potential performance improvement Finally, we present experimental results from a TD-CDMA system that has intercell interference mitigation enabled.
